    The Science Behind Duravein™: Durability Meets Biology

    Let's talk about the Duravein™ bio-prosthetic material, because, honestly, it's one of the coolest parts of what Anteris Technologies Corporation is doing. You know how sometimes you hear about medical devices failing over time? A big reason for that, especially with heart valves, is calcification and degradation. The Duravein™ material is designed specifically to combat these issues. It's derived from animal pericardial tissue, which is a natural, robust material. But here’s where the magic happens: Anteris uses a proprietary cross-linking technology to treat this tissue. This process essentially strengthens the material, making it incredibly resistant to calcification – that hardening process that can make artificial valves stiff and ineffective over time. It also enhances its durability, meaning it’s built to last. Think of it like reinforcing a natural structure to make it even stronger and more resilient. This scientific approach is crucial because the mitral valve is constantly working, beating millions of times a year. It needs a material that can withstand that relentless stress without breaking down. The goal is to create a prosthetic that behaves as closely as possible to a healthy, native valve, providing excellent hemodynamics (how blood flows through it) and long-term function. By using Duravein™, Anteris aims to reduce the need for re-operations down the line, which are often riskier and more complex than the initial procedure.
